For my mummy, I decided to have a go at making a cupcake bouquet. Ruth of  The Pink Whisk makes one with the cakes held up on clear dowels, like flowers on a stem, arranged in a vase. I didn’t have time to get to the supply shop for dowells, so I used a terracotta flower pot and aranged them in that.

I took a plain flower pot, lined it with some cellophane, a sheet of tissue, and a big handful of shredded paper.

Flower Pot

Lined Flower Pot

 

I made some lemon cupcakes and some butter cream which I divided and coloured pink and lilac using edible coloured dust.  Then I piped the icing using a star nozzle on 2 of the cakes and a ribbon nozzle on the other 2, to create some texture on my cake “blooms”. I sprinkled them with some edible shimmer crystals and arranged them in the flower pot.  A few sprigs of foliage from one of the plants in the garden, a gingham ribbon around the pot and hey presto!
